Knee Dislocation

摘要

Knee dislocations have historically been severe and potentially limb-threatening injuries. Over the last several decades, the diagnosis, treatment, and rehabilitation for knee dislocations have improved, leading to improved patient outcomes and knee function. A thorough physical examination including assessment of neurovascular status and the integrity of all ligaments and soft tissue structures of the knee is necessary for a comprehensive treatment plan. The use of stress radiographs, in combination with magnetic resonance imaging, is recommended to assess the functional status of the cruciate and collateral ligaments of the knee. An anatomic-based reconstruction approach within the acute treatment period following injury is recommended. In order to allow early functional rehabilitation, Patients who undergo anatomic-based reconstructions, followed by early postoperative rehabilitation focusing on protected range of motion and quadriceps strengthening, have shown optimal outcomes. With these principles, improved knee function and activity level can be expected; however, return to preinjury activity level cannot be expected.
